Norwegians are proud of their beer brewing traditions! Today, Aass is the only family owned brewery left in the country.
There is a total ban on alcohol advertising in Norway, which is the reason why Aass has posted anything but images of beer on their website.
‘Today Aass Brewery is a modern industrial company with deep roots in the old beer brewing traditions. Culture is an integral part of our identity and we see it as our task to raise the status of beer in Norway.
In earlier times, there were 12 breweries locally, and now Aass Brewery is the only one left. We have a central position in the urban scene and are still in the same location where the original business started in 1834.
The production of soft drinks started in 1869 and is still an important area for Aass Brewery. In addition to being co-owner of A / S Solo, we produce varieties of carbonated soft drinks and soda water‘.
